Skip to content

Commit 9880d74

Browse files
ozgentimopollmeier
authored andcommitted
Fix: Get openvasd status before getting openvasd results
1 parent 40362f4 commit 9880d74

File tree

1 file changed

+7
-6
lines changed

1 file changed

+7
-6
lines changed

src/manage.c

+7-6
Original file line numberDiff line numberDiff line change
@@ -9019,19 +9019,20 @@ handle_openvasd_scan (task_t task, report_t report, const char *scan_id)
90199019

90209020
set_report_slave_progress (report, progress);
90219021

9022-
openvasd_parsed_results (connector, result_start,
9023-
result_end, &results);
9024-
result_start += g_slist_length (results);
9025-
9026-
gvm_sleep(1);
90279022
openvasd_scan_status = openvasd_parsed_scan_status (connector);
90289023
start_time = openvasd_scan_status->start_time;
90299024
end_time = openvasd_scan_status->end_time;
9030-
90319025
current_status = openvasd_scan_status->status;
90329026
progress = openvasd_scan_status->progress;
90339027
g_free (openvasd_scan_status);
90349028

9029+
gvm_sleep (1);
9030+
9031+
openvasd_parsed_results (connector, result_start,
9032+
result_end, &results);
9033+
9034+
result_start += g_slist_length (results);
9035+
90359036
parse_openvasd_report (task, report, results, start_time,
90369037
end_time);
90379038
if (results != NULL)

0 commit comments

Comments
 (0)